There are many that will tell you that men do not get abused. That is something that we tell ourselves to allow us to sleep well at night but it has little to do with reality. The reality is that men do get abused and I believe that they get abused in similar numbers as women do.
The difference is that men are less likely to report it to authorities when it does happen. Also when they do do the police file the report as a domestic assault or just as a simple assault? It makes a big difference as to how it is handled within the system. If a man accuses his wife or girlfriend of domestic assault and it is recorded as a simple assault it never hits the system and the abuse never happened.
Things have changed and men have been abused for years and now it is time that they get the same treatment that everyone else gets. It is not ok to say that it does not happen, that they deserved it or that it is not as bad. Abuse is abuse and there is no acceptable boundary for when it is ok. Domestic violence needs to come to an end, no one deserves to be abused.
